Muffaletta Sandwich with The Brooklyn Beast
Ingredients:
Homemade Olive spread:
½ cup chopped pitted green olives|
½ cup chopped pitted Kalamata olives
1 (3-ounce jar) pimentos, drained
¼ cup chopped fresh parsley
¼ cup extra-virgin olive oil
2 cloves garlic, minced
2 tablespoons white wine vinegar
1 teaspoon dried oregano
Freshly ground black pepper, to taste
Sandwich:
4 Brooklyn Beasts buns, sliced in half lengthwise
Homemade Olive Spread
6 ounces soppressata, thinly sliced
8 ounces provolone, sliced
6 ounces deli ham, thinly slices
6 ounces mortadella, thinly sliced
6 ounces salami, thinly sliced
Olives on toothpick, for serving
Directions:
Homemade Olive Spread:
Combine olives, pimentos, parsley, olive oil, garlic, vinegar, dried oregano and pepper in a large bowl. Toss to combine. Set aside to marinate.
Sandwiches:
Assemble Muffuletta. Hollow out the top piece of the bun by removing some of the soft bread on the inside, leaving a ½-inch of bread near the crust. Spread half of the olive spread on the bottom bun. Layer with the meats and provolone cheese. Spread remaining olive spread on top of last layer of meat and top with the hollowed out top bun. Press down lightly and allow to sit for 10 minutes.
